- zk-SNARKs: как технологии подтверждения делают блокчейн быстрее и безопаснее
- Что такое zk-SNARKs: краткое введение
- Как работают zk-SNARKs: основные принципы
- В чем преимущества технологии zk-SNARKs
- Применение zk-SNARKs в мире блокчейнов
- Основные области внедрения
- Преимущества и недостатки zk-SNARKs
- Плюсы
- Минусы
- Будущее zk-SNARKs: перспективы и вызовы
- Основные тренды
zk-SNARKs: как технологии подтверждения делают блокчейн быстрее и безопаснее
В современном мире блокчейн-технологии играют важнейшую роль в обеспечении децентрализованных финансовых систем‚ цифровых активов и смарт-контрактов. Однако один из основных вызовов — это их масштабируемость и безопасность. В этом контексте на сцене появился мощный инструмент — zk-SNARKs. Эти криптографические доказательства позволяют подтверждать выполнение сложных вычислений без необходимости раскрывать саму информацию‚ что значительно увеличивает эффективность и безопасность сетей.
Давайте вместе разберемся‚ что такое zk-SNARKs‚ как они работают‚ и какую революцию могут принести в мир блокчейн-технологий. Нам предстоит понять тонкости технологии‚ а также ее преимущества и потенциал для будущего криптовалют и распределенных систем.
Что такое zk-SNARKs: краткое введение
zk-SNARKs — это криптографический протокол‚ который позволяет одному участнику (доказателю) подтвердить другому (верификатору)‚ что он знает определенную информацию или что вычисление выполнено правильно‚ без раскрытия самой информации или вычислений. Название происходит от:
- zero-knowledge, доказательство с нулевым разглашением;
- Succinct — короткое и быстро проверяемое доказательство;
- Non-interactive — без необходимости многократных взаимодействий между сторонами;
- Arguable — аргумент эффективности доказательства;
- Knowledge — подтверждение знания конкретной информации.
Этот протокол позволяет значительно повысить скорость работы блокчейнов‚ снизить объем данных для хранения и обеспечить высокий уровень приватности.
Как работают zk-SNARKs: основные принципы
Чтобы понять‚ как именно работают zk-SNARKs‚ стоит разобраться в их механике. Основная идея состоит в использовании сложных математических преобразований и криптографических алгоритмов‚ позволяющих создавать доказательства‚ которые невозможно подделать и проверить очень быстро.
Процесс можно разбить на несколько ключевых этапов:
- Ключи: подготовка — создаются два набора ключей: секретный (для генерации доказательств) и публичный (для проверки).
- Генерация доказательства — доказатель создает доказательство о выполнении вычислений‚ основываясь на секретных данных и исходных входных данных.
- Проверка доказательства, verifier использует публичный ключ‚ чтобы убедиться в правильности доказательства‚ не зная саму секретную информацию.
Таким образом‚ zk-SNARKs позволяют доказать‚ что вычисление выполнено корректно‚ при этом скрывая содержимое данных.
В чем преимущества технологии zk-SNARKs
Преимущества использования zk-SNARKs трудно переоценить. Они не только повышают эффективность работы блокчейн-сетей‚ но и существенно усиливают приватность пользователей.
- Масштабируемость, благодаря коротким доказательствам и быстрой проверке снижают нагрузку на сеть.
- Приватность — позволяют скрывать содержимое транзакции‚ сохраняя при этом ее валидность.
- Безопасность, криптографическая сложность обеспечивает невозможность подделки доказательств.
- Универсальность — применимы не только в криптовалютах‚ но и в других сферах‚ например‚ в верификации данных‚ голосовании и т. д.
Применение zk-SNARKs в мире блокчейнов
Самое очевидное применение zk-SNARKs — это проект Zcash‚ который использует их для обеспечения анонимных транзакций. Однако список возможностей значительно шире.
Основные области внедрения
| Область | Описание |
|---|---|
| Криптовалюты с приватностью | Обеспечивают полную анонимность транзакций без раскрытия данных о отправителе‚ получателе и сумме. |
| Масштабируемость блокчейнов | Уменьшают нагрузку на сеть‚ позволяя проверять большие объемы информации за минимальное время. |
| Верификация данных | Обеспечивают подтверждение правильности данных без их раскрытия‚ например‚ в системах голосования или аккредитации. |
| Криптографические протоколы | Используются для построения сложных сценариев приватных вычислений в силу их высокой надежности. |
| Защита личных данных | В сферах медицины‚ банковских услуг‚ социальных сетях — для защиты конфиденциальной информации. |
Преимущества и недостатки zk-SNARKs
Несмотря на впечатляющие возможности‚ технология zk-SNARKs не лишена своих особенностей и иногда вызывает вопросы.
Плюсы
- Высокая эффективность, короткие доказательства и быстрая проверка позволяют масштабировать системы.
- Высокий уровень приватности — скрытие данных без потери валидации транзакций.
- Широкие области применения — от криптовалют до защищенных вычислений.
Минусы
- Сложность реализации — разработка и интеграция требуют высокой криптографической подготовки.
- Проблемы с масштабируемостью в процессе генерации, создание доказательств иногда занимает значительное время.
- Потребность в доверенных установках — некоторые реализации требуют заложенного доверия при генерации ключей.
Что важнее в новой криптотехнологии — скорость или приватность? Почему именно эти параметры считаются ключевыми для развития блокчейнов?
Будущее zk-SNARKs: перспективы и вызовы
Технология zk-SNARKs находится в постоянном развитии и уже демонстрирует значительный потенциал для трансформации цифрового мира. Однако впереди стоят ряд технических вызовов‚ требующих дальнейших исследований и инновационных решений.
Основные тренды
- Разработка более быстрых алгоритмов генерации доказательств.
- Создание более безопасных доверенных установок и ключевых схем.
- Интеграция с другими протоколами шифрования и системами приватности.
- Расширение применения в межгосударственных и корпоративных системах.
В конечном счете‚ zk-SNARKs — это мощный инструмент‚ который открывает новые горизонты для блокчейн-технологий и криптографии. Их способность объединять приватность‚ безопасность и масштабируемость делает их неотъемлемой частью будущего цифровых систем‚ где конфиденциальность и скорость будут цениться так же высоко‚ как и безопасность.
Как вы считаете‚ какие из новых технологий‚ подобных zk-SNARKs‚ будут в будущем играть ключевую роль в развитии цифрового пространства?
Подробнее
| Масштабируемость блокчейна | Приватность транзакций | Криптографические протоколы | Применение zk-SNARKs | Будущее zk-SNARKs |
| Технология zero-knowledge | Масштабируемость блокчейнов | Криптография вычислений | Технология приватности | Развитие технологий |








